Signs‌ ‌of‌ ‌Binge‌ ‌Drinking‌ ‌

Binge drinking involves drinking to a point where your blood alcohol level is .08 grams percent or above. This typically equates to four standard alcoholic drinks for women and five for men over a two-hour time period.
